Dried Bananas








Have you ever had a dried banana? Probably not unless you dried them yourself. Banana chips that you can buy at the store are actually fried and not truly dried. 
Making your own dried bananas is so easy, and bananas are relatively inexpensive so they're also pretty cheap to make. I like to mix them with other dried fruits, nuts, and other things to make a trail mix. 

All you need is some bananas, coconut oil, a baking sheet, and an oven.

1. Set your oven to about 150 degrees. You want to dry them, not cook them so make sure it's low.
2. Slice your bananas
2. Coat a baking sheet with coconut oil
3. Spread your banana slices on your baking sheet and put it in the oven over night. 
4. You should have dried bananas when you wake up in the morning. If they're not done, you may want to flip them and put them back in for a couple more hours.
